前言

在写nodejs爬虫的过程中,原网站可能会对某一时间段内集中访问该页面的ip进行封杀。那么如何动态设置每次爬取使用的ip地址以及浏览器头部信息呢?

动态userAgent

这是我收集到的常用的浏览器头部信息,每次爬取的时候从中随机选取一个,并使用superAgent设置请求头部的User-Agent字段就好了。

userAgent.js

]

module.exports = userAgents

    app.js

    import request from \'superagent\'
    import userAgents from \'../src/userAgent\'
    
    async function doRequest(){
        let userAgent = userAgents[parseInt(Math.random() * userAgents.length)]
        request.get(\'http://www.xxx.com\')
        .set({ \'User-Agent\': userAgent })
        .timeout({ response: 5000, deadline: 60000 })
        .end(async(err, res) => {
          // 处理数据
        })
    }

      动态ip

      设置动态IP需要用到一个superagent插件—superagent-proxy,除此之外为了避免每次爬取时都去获取一次动态IP的列表,我将爬取到的动态IP列表存放在redis中,并设置10分钟的过期时间。数据过期之后再重新发送获取动态IP的请求。

      ps: 这里我使用的动态IP是爬虫网络科技公司提供的免费代理,因为免费所以难免会有些缺陷。有时候使用他的代理ip并不能访问得通,我在后面会做单独的处理。

        app.js

        import request from \'superagent\'
        import requestProxy from \'superagent-proxy\'
        import redis from \'redis\'
        // superagent添加使用代理ip的插件
        requestProxy(request)
        // redis promise化
        bluebird.promisifyAll(redis.RedisClient.prototype)
        bluebird.promisifyAll(redis.Multi.prototype)
        // 建立mongoose和redis连接
        const redisClient = connectRedis()
        
        /**
         * 初始化redis
         */
        function connectRedis() {
          let client = redis.createClient(config.REDIS_URL)
          client.on("ready", function(err) {
            console.log(\'redis连接 √\')
          })
          client.on("error", function(err) {
            console.log(`redis错误,${err}  ×`);
          })
          return client
        }
        
        
        /**
         * 请求免费代理,读取redis,如果代理信息已经过期,重新请求免费代理请求
         */
        async function getProxyIp() {
          // 先从redis读取缓存ip
          let localIpStr = await redisClient.getAsync(\'proxy_ips\')
          let ips = null
          // 如果本地存在,则随机返回其中一个ip,否则重新请求
          if (localIpStr) {
            let localIps = localIpStr.split(\',\')
            return localIps[parseInt(Math.random() * localIps.length)]
          } else {
            let ipsJson = (await request.get(\'http://api.pcdaili.com/?order)).body
            let isRequestSuccess = false
            if (ipsJson && ipsJson.data.proxy_list) {
              ips = ipsJson.data.proxy_list
              isRequestSuccess = true
            } else {
              ips = [\'http://127.0.0.1\']
            }
            // 将爬取结果存入本地,缓存时间10分钟
            if (isRequestSuccess) {
              redisClient.set("proxy_ips", ips.join(\',\'), \'EX\', 10 * 60)
            }
            return ips[parseInt(Math.random() * ips.length)]
          }
        }
        
        async function doRequest(){
          let userAgent = userAgents[parseInt(Math.random() * userAgents.length)]
          let ip = await getProxyIp()
          let useIp = \'http://\' + ip
          request.get(\'http://www.xxx.com\')
            .set({ \'User-Agent\': userAgent })
            .timeout({ response: 5000, deadline: 60000 })
            .proxy(ip)
            .end(async(err, res) => {
              // 处理数据
            })
        }
        

          之前说爬虫网络科技的免费ip有些缺陷—代理成功率有些低。这点必须想办法去修复,原理其实很简单,既然一次不成功那我就换个IP再试,直到成功了我才去开始执行解析html的逻辑

          async function doRequest(){
            let userAgent = userAgents[parseInt(Math.random() * userAgents.length)]
            let ip = await getProxyIp()
            let useIp = \'http://\' + ip
            request.get(\'http://www.xxx.com\')
              .set({ \'User-Agent\': userAgent })
              .timeout({ response: 5000, deadline: 60000 })
              .proxy(ip)
              .end(async(err, res) => {
                if (err) {
                  console.log(`爬取页面失败,${err},正在重新寻找代理ip... ×`)
                  // 如果是代理ip无法访问,另外选择一个代理
                  doRequest(\'http://\' + await getProxyIp(), userAgents[parseInt(Math.random() * userAgents.length)])
                  return
                }
                // 解析html
                console.log(\'爬取页面  √\')
                await parseDivision(res.text)
              })
          }
